Anubis: A Thoughtful Compromise

Anubis represents a thoughtful compromise in this battle against AI-driven aggression. Drawing inspiration from Hashcash—a proposed solution aimed at curbing email spam through computational challenges—Anubis employs a Proof-of-Work scheme tailored for the digital age. The beauty of this approach lies in its scalability; while individual human users experience negligible additional load, mass-scale scrapers encounter exponentially increasing costs and hurdles. This strategic imposition acts as a deterrent, preserving website integrity and accessibility.

Beyond Immediate Solutions: A Vision for Fingerprinting

Anubis is more than just an immediate shield; it is a stepping stone toward more sophisticated solutions. The ultimate goal lies in advancing techniques like fingerprinting to identify and differentiate between genuine human users and headless browsers—a type of automated tool that navigates websites without a graphical interface. By honing the ability to detect these entities, particularly through nuanced methods such as analyzing font rendering, Anubis aims to refine its approach, ensuring that legitimate users are not hindered by unnecessary challenges.
